▸ View Original Clause Language DOCUMENT RECORD
"
If this Agreement is terminated for cause by WHOOP or if your Account or ability to access the Services is discontinued by WHOOP due to your violation of any portion of this Agreement...you agree that you shall not attempt to re-register with or access the Services through use of a different member name.

Excerpt from Whoop's Terms of Use
